Reading RaceFrom Donna Dinizo-Ruhl, a teacher at Roosevelt School in South Plainfield, New Jersey:
"To foster a love of reading, I show my class books that I am reading on my own time. They are thrilled by the size of them! In class, I made a large race track out of bulletin board paper and had the kids color in race cars that I printed from the Internet. I gave them all a sheet to keep track of how much time they read outside of class which the parents initial. Their goal is to make it all the way around the track, which is labeled by minutes. Once they have all made it around, we have an ice cream party. They can't wait to move their cars everyday!"
